    There are two ways to link to files with iWeb. The approach that iWebFaq outlines results in iWeb making a copy of the file in question and storing it in the domain.sites file. Then, when it publishes your website, it puts a copy of the file in the right place in the folders it publishes. Visitors to your site then download that copy.
    You are correct that you can put things in your public folder of your iDisk for download. But the process of linking to those files is different. When you set up the link in iWeb (using the inspector) you need to choose "external link" and provide the url of the file in question.
    For more background on the differences between these approaches, and the advantages of each, see this thread. That thread also has some good links for sorting out what the url of the files in your public (and other) folders of your iDisk are.

    Unfortunately iWeb cannot read or import previously published files, only generate them.  You'll have to recreate your site from scratch.
    However, Chapter 2.3 on the iWeb FAQ.org site has tips on using some of the existing files, image, audio, video, etc., from the published site in the recreation of the site.

  • How do I get my Old iWeb Sites off my External HD (1 Domain file) and onto my new internal HD?

    I justrecently had to replace my internal HD on my iMac. Before doing it, I backed up my 2 iWeb Sites (the Domain File) onto my external HD.
    Now I have a new Internal HD on my iMac.
    When I open my domain file located on my external HD, iWeb opens. Now I'd like to save the file back onto my internal HD.
    How do I save my 2 web sites that I now see on the left back onto my internal HD. (When I click on "File", "Save", it just saves it again on the external HD, because it's reading the file from the external HD?)
    Thanks....
    Brian

    You need to copy the domain.sites file from the external hard drive into your Users/Home/Library/Application Support/iWeb folder on the new hard drive. If there is no iWeb folder in the Applicaiton Support folder create one.
    Be sure it's your home library that you're working in.
